#d1496c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d1496c is composed of 82% red, 28.6% green and 42.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 65.1% magenta, 48.3%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 344.6 degrees, a saturation of 59.6% and a lightness of 55.3%. #d1496c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ff92d8 with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3366.

Shades and Tints of #d1496c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060103 is the darkest color, while #fdf5f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d1496c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#94868a is the less saturated color, while #fd1d57 is the most saturated one.
